The Historical and Legal Context

Historically, Russia (and the Soviet Union before it) was when one of the world's leading producers of commercial hemp. Utilized for rope, textiles, and oil, hemp was a staple of the agrarian economy. However, as international drug treaties progressed in the mid-20th century, the difference in between commercial hemp and psychedelic cannabis blurred in the eyes of Russian legislators.

Today, the Russian Federation keeps some of the strictest anti-drug laws in the world. Cannabis is categorized as a Schedule I substance under the "List of Narcotic Drugs, Psychotropic Substances, and Their Precursors." This indicates it is thought about to have actually no recognized medical worth and a high potential for abuse.

Existing Legal Status of Cannabis Edibles

Under Russian law, there is no specific category for "edibles." Instead, they are treated as "mixes including a narcotic compound." This category is especially unsafe for customers since of how the Weight is determined for prosecution.

In lots of jurisdictions, the law takes a look at the purity or the particular weight of the THC within an edible. In Russia, the entire weight of the item is normally used to determine the seriousness of the offense. If a person is discovered with a 200-gram batch of cannabis-infused brownies, the biological weight of the flour, sugar, and butter is often computed as 200 grams of a "narcotic mix."

Penalties and Weight Thresholds

The Russian Criminal Code (specifically Articles 228 and 228.1) dictates the charges for the possession, production, and sale of drugs. The severity of the penalty is figured out by the weight of the substance took.

Table 1: Weight Thresholds for Cannabis and Derivatives in Russia

SubstanceConsiderable Amount (grams)Large Amount (grams)Especially Large Amount (grams)
Cannabis (Marijuana)6g-- 100g100g-- 100,000 gOver 100,000 g
Hashish (Resin)2g-- 25g25g-- 10,000 gOver 10,000 g
Hashish Oil0.4 g-- 5g5g-- 1,000 gOver 1,000 g

Note: For edibles, if the product is categorized as a "mix" consisting of THC or hashish oil, the total weight of the edible can rapidly push the offense into the "Large" or "Especially Large" classification.

Key Risks Associated with Edibles in Russia

The usage and ownership of edibles bring distinct threats in the Russian legal environment that differ from smoking flower.

  • The Weight Trap: As discussed, the overall weight of the food product is often used in court. A single heavy cookie can lead to a "Large Amount" charge, which brings a much heavier jail sentence than easy belongings of a little bag of flower.
  • Detection Challenges: While edibles do not have the distinct odor of cannabis smoke, Russian police makes use of advanced drug-sniffing pets and mobile lab screening in metropolitan centers and transit centers.
  • No Medical Exception: There is no legal arrangement for "medical cannabis." Bringing cannabis edibles into the nation with a foreign prescription is still thought about smuggling (Article 229.1 of the Criminal Code).

Law Enforcement and "Article 228"

Article 228 of the Russian Criminal Code is frequently described by activists and residents as the "People's Article" since of the sheer number of people jailed under its arrangements.

Penalties for Possession and Sale

  1. Administrative Offense: Possession of quantities below the "Significant" limit (e.g., less than 6g of flower) generally results in a great or approximately 15 days of administrative detention. Nevertheless, for edibles, staying under these thresholds is nearly difficult due to the weight of the food provider.
  2. Wrongdoer Possession (Article 228): Possession of a "Significant Amount" can cause as much as 3 years in jail. A "Large Amount" can lead to 3 to 10 years.
  3. Production and Sale (Article 228.1): The circulation of edibles is dealt with much more roughly. Sentences for the sale of narcotics can vary from 4 years to life imprisonment, depending upon the scale and involvement of an orderly group.

Table 2: Potential Sentences for Narcotic-Related Offenses

OffensePotential Sentence
Little scale possession (Administrative)Fine (4,000-- 5,000 RUB) or 15 days detention
Substantial amount ownershipUp to 3 years imprisonment
Large quantity ownership3 to 10 years jail time
Especially big quantity possession10 to 15 years jail time
Sale or Distribution4 years to Life Imprisonment

Practical Information for Foreigners

Foreign nationals are frequently at higher threat due to the fact that they may originate from jurisdictions where edibles are legal and might dislike the intensity of Russian Law.

  • Customs and Smuggling: Attempting to bring cannabis gummies or chocolates through Russian customizeds is classified as "Narcotics Smuggling." This is a separate, more severe charge that typically leads to immediate detention and long-lasting jail time, regardless of the individual's intent.
  • Deportation: Any administrative or criminal drug offense typically leads to instant deportation and a lifetime restriction from entering the Russian Federation after the sentence is served.
  • Legal Representation: The Russian legal system has an extremely low acquittal rate in drug cases. Defense frequently concentrates on procedural mistakes rather than arguing for the legality of the substance.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Is medical cannabis legal in Russia if I have a prescription from my home country?

No. Russia does not acknowledge foreign medical marijuana prescriptions. Bringing any kind of cannabis, including edibles, into the nation is thought about drug smuggling.

2. Are CBD gummies legal in Russia?

3. What happens if I am caught with a single cannabis brownie?

Because the weight of the entire brownie (the "mixture") is counted, a single brownie (e.g., 100 grams) might be classified as a "Large Amount." This might lead to a criminal case under Article 228 with a prospective jail sentence of 3 to 10 years.

4. Does the law identify in between Delta-8 and Delta-9 THC in edibles?

No. All isomers and derivatives of THC are dealt with as forbidden psychotropic substances under Russian law.

5. Can I buy cannabis edibles on the "Dark Web" in Russia?

While illegal marketplaces exist, Russian authorities actively keep an eye on these networks. Purchasing through these channels includes a high risk of "regulated shipments," where police arrest the recipient at the point of pickup.

6. Are hemp seeds or hemp oil legal?
